Output 41832625f7a34ca4fa52ce9ac59d4d6980e20c08248c68a8ec023bfc594f602f:1

value
341033
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4632367515ce0cd6ab5c252012a3fd47fd65609c OP_EQUALVERIFY OP_CHECKSIG
address
17QATGd8iqG6qCZzuPvjukSYMdkxKTwgKs
transaction
41832625f7a34ca4fa52ce9ac59d4d6980e20c08248c68a8ec023bfc594f602f
spent
true